Indurate
a.
- Hardened; not soft; indurated.
- Without sensibility; unfeeling; obdurate.
Indurate
v. t.
imp. & p. p. Indurated; p. pr. & vb. n. Indurating
- To make hard; as, extreme heat indurates clay; some fossils are indurated by exposure to the air.
- To make unfeeling; to deprive of sensibility; to render obdurate.
Indurate
v. i.
- To grow hard; to harden, or become hard; as, clay indurates by drying, and by heat.
